Dayton is a city in southwestern Ohio. Dayton plays host to significant industrial, aerospace, and research activity and is known for the many technical innovations and inventions developed there. The city was the home of the Wright Brothers, poet Paul Laurence Dunbar, and entrepreneur John H. Patterson.
Dayton is nicknamed the Gem City, and is also sometimes referred to as the "Birthplace of Aviation." The area is home to several major international and regional corporations, including NCR, Reynolds & Reynolds, Relizon, Huffy Bicycles, Lexis Nexis, and formally Mead.
